BODY,TD,FONT,SPAN,INPUT {
	font-size: 12px;
	font-family: Tahoma, Verdana, Arial;
}
a {text-decoration: underline;color: #0099cc;}
a:hover {color: #ff6633;text-decoration: underline;}
a:active {color: #ff6633;text-decoration: underline;}
a:focus {color: #ff6633;text-decoration: underline;}

.white {color: #FFFFFF; text-decoration:none}
a:hover.white  {color: #FFFFFF; text-decoration:none}
a:active.white {color: #FFFFFF; text-decoration:none}
a:focus.white  {color: #FFFFFF; text-decoration:none}
a:hover.upmenu {color: #666666; text-decoration:none}

.pods {color: #666666;text-decoration:none;font-weight:bold;}
a:hover.pods  {color: #666666; text-decoration:none}
a:active.pods {color: #666666; text-decoration:none}
a:focus.pods  {color: #666666; text-decoration:none}

#preloadmenu { 
width: 0px; 
height: 0px; 
display: inline; 
background-image: url(img/flago.gif) 
}
#man{
width:219px;
height:160px;
background-image:url(img/man.gif); background-position:left; background-repeat:no-repeat;
}
#news {
padding-top:35px;
padding-left:38px;
background-image:url(img/bgnews.gif); background-repeat:no-repeat; background-position:left top;
color:#666666;
font-size:11px;
text-align: left;
}
#str {
position:absolute; padding-top:150px;
}
#manall{
width:100%;
background-image:url(img/man.gif); background-position:left; background-repeat:no-repeat; 
}
#nostr{
background-repeat:no-repeat; background-position:left ;
}
#news2 {
width:100%;
height:100%;
padding-top:26px;
background-color:#FFFFFF
}
#go {
text-align:right;
}
#ul {
background-image:url(img/ul.gif) ; background-position:left top; background-repeat:no-repeat; background-color:#f2f2f2; 
}
#ur {
background-image:url(img/ur.gif) ; background-position:right top; background-repeat:no-repeat; 
}
#dl {
background-image:url(img/dl.gif) ; background-position:left bottom; background-repeat:no-repeat; padding-left:27px; padding-top:11px; padding-right:23px; padding-bottom:9px;
padding-right:15px; 
}
#dr{
background-image:url(img/dr.gif) ; background-position:right bottom; background-repeat:no-repeat; 
}
#newspad {
padding-top:21px; padding-bottom:21px;
}
#allnews {
height:24px; width:120px; background-image:url(img/bgnewsall.gif); background-repeat:no-repeat; padding-left:22px; padding-top:5px; font-size:11px; vertical-align: top;text-align: justify;}
#content {
padding-top:110px;
}
#contnavi{
width:100%;
background-image:url(img/bgcontentd.gif); background-position:right; background-repeat:repeat-x;}
#cru{
background-image:url(img/bgcontentur.gif); background-repeat:no-repeat; background-position: right;
}
#shar {
background-image:url(img/shar.gif); background-position:top; background-repeat:no-repeat;
}
#bgcontu {
BORDER-top: #0099cc 3px solid;
width:30%;
margin-top:6px}
#headbug {
width:100%;
padding-left:21px;
background-image:url(img/sharup.gif); background-position:left; background-repeat:no-repeat;
}
#headmenuo {
BORDER-bottom: #ff9933 2px solid;
margin-top:6px}
#bgcdr{
background-image:url(img/bgcontentdr.gif); background-position: bottom right; background-repeat:no-repeat;
}
#bgcr{
background-image:url(img/bgcontentr.gif); background-position:right; background-repeat:repeat-y;}
#bgcd{
background-image:url(img/bgcontentd.gif); background-position:bottom; background-repeat:repeat-x; padding-right:5%; padding-left:2%;
line-height: 17px;
}
#contfoot{
width:100%;
height:41px;}
#contfootto{
width:100%;
height:21px;
}
#rigtnavigation{
padding-left:31px;
padding-top:80px;
}
#rightnavm {
padding-top: 31px;
padding-right:41px;
}
#zakazl {
width: 100%;
height: 113px;
background-image:url(img/zakbgl.gif); background-repeat:no-repeat; background-position:left;
}
#zakazr {
width: 100%;
height: 113px;
background-image:url(img/zakbgr.gif); background-repeat:no-repeat; background-position:right;
}
#zakazbg {
width: 100%;
height: 100%;
background-image:url(img/zakbg.gif); background-repeat:repeat-x; margin-left:11px
}
#mash {
width: 100%;
background-image:url(img/mashinka.gif); background-repeat:no-repeat; background-position:center;
}
#bgmashl {
background-image:url(img/leftmash.gif); background-position:left; background-repeat:no-repeat;}
#bgmashr {
background-image:url(img/rightmash.gif); background-position:right; background-repeat:no-repeat;}
#bgmashk {
width: 100%;
background-image:url(img/bgmas.gif); background-repeat:repeat-x; background-position:center}
#zakaz {
padding-top:80px;
padding-left:5%;
}
#rightnavf {
padding-top: 31px;
padding-right:41px;
}
#forml {
width: 100%;
height: 113px;
background-image:url(img/forml.gif); background-repeat:no-repeat; background-position:left;
}
#sam {
width: 100%;
height: 113px;
background-image:url(img/sam.gif); background-repeat:no-repeat; background-position:center;
}
#formr {
width: 100%;
height: 113px;
background-image:url(img/formr.gif); background-position:right; background-repeat:no-repeat;}
#konv {
width: 100%;
background-image:url(img/formk.gif); background-repeat:no-repeat; background-position:center;}
#mapl {
width: 100%;
height: 113px;
background-image:url(img/bglmap.gif); background-repeat:no-repeat; background-position:left;
}
#map {
width: 100%;
background-image:url(img/map.gif); background-repeat:no-repeat; background-position:center;}
#rightnavkor {
padding-top: 31px;
padding-right:41px;
}
#sbgruz {
width: 100%;
background-image:url(img/sbgruz.gif); background-repeat:no-repeat; background-position:center;}
#rightnavkor {
padding-top: 31px;
padding-right:41px;
}
#kor {
width: 100%;
background-image:url(img/korabl.gif); background-repeat:no-repeat; background-position:center;}
#mashlogo{
width: 100%;
background-image:url(img/mashlogo.gif); background-repeat:no-repeat; background-position:center;}
#sbgruz {
width: 100%;
background-image:url(img/sbgruz.gif); background-repeat:no-repeat; background-position:center;}

#lfoot{
height: 91px;
padding-left: 31px;
background-color: #ffffff;
}
#lfootl {
height: 91px;
padding-left:29px;
background-color: #f2f2f2;
background-image:url(img/ul.gif); background-repeat:no-repeat;
font-size:11px;
text-align: left;
color:#666666;
}
#icmash{
height: 21px;
padding-top:20px;
}
#contfooter{
height: 91px;
background-color: #f2f2f2;
color:#666666;
font-size:11px;
text-align: left;
background-image:url(img/ur.gif); background-position:top right; background-repeat:no-repeat;
}
#bgcont {
BORDER-top: #0099cc 3px solid;
width:30%;
height:12px}
#virt{
padding-left:41px;
}
#pikt{
width:100%;
background-image:url(img/pik1g.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#pabout{
width:100%;
background-image:url(img/pabout.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#puslgr{
width:100%;
background-image:url(img/glob.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#ohr{
width:100%;
background-image:url(img/ohr.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#ots{
width:100%;
background-image:url(img/ots.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#gruz{
width:100%;
background-image:url(img/gruz.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#negabar{
width:100%;
background-image:url(img/negabar.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#opas{
width:100%;
background-image:url(img/opas.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#leftnavig{
padding-top:85px;
}
#users{
width:100%;
background-image:url(img/users.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#inform{
width:100%;
background-image:url(img/inform.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#contact{
width:100%;
background-image:url(img/contact.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#tamoz{
width:100%;
background-image:url(img/tamoz.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#zapr{
width:100%;
background-image:url(img/zapr.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
#ya{
width:100%;
background-image:url(img/ya.gif); background-position:top; background-repeat:no-repeat; padding-top:135px;
}
h1{
color: #0099cc;
font-weight: bold;
font-size:12px;
}
h2{
color: #0099cc;
font-weight: bold;
font-size:13px;
}
.colb{
color: #b3b3b3; font-weight: bold;
height: 100%;
background-color: #FFFFFF;
text-decoration:none}
.b{
color:#000000;
font-size:12px;
font-weight:bold;
}
.s{
color: #0099cc;
font-weight: bold;
font-size:12px;
}
.o{
color: #ff6633;
font-weight: bold;
font-size:12px;
}
#pt16{
padding-top:16px}
.upmenu{
color: #666666;
text-decoration:none;
font-weight: bold;
}
#pd11 {
padding-top:11px;
}
#pd20 {
padding-top:12px;
font-size:13px;
font-weight:bold;
}
#pd10 {
margin-left:20px;
padding-top:5px;
}
#pd55{
padding-top:85px;
}
#all{
font-size:11px;
text-align: left;
color:#666666;}
#all a{
font-size:11px;
text-align: left;
color:#666666;
text-decoration:none;}
#allg a{
font-size:11px;
text-align: left;
color:#666666;
text-decoration:underline;}



